Talk:MapStructure Optimizations: Difference between revisions

From FlightGear wiki
Jump to navigation Jump to search
(→‎test: new section)
 
Line 14: Line 14:


</syntaxhighlight>
</syntaxhighlight>
== test ==
{{#vardefine:variablename|specifiedvalue}}

Latest revision as of 16:59, 21 October 2017

selectable Ranges API

var  setSelectableMapRangesNm = func (range_vector, unit='nm') {
foreach(var range; range_vector) {
 var groupName = sprintf("visibility-range-%d-%s",range, unit);
 map.createChild("group", groupName);
 }# foreach range
};

# range based allocation of layers/groups
setSelectableMapRangesNm( [5,10, 20, 40, 80, 160, 320, 640] );

test

{{#vardefine:variablename|specifiedvalue}}